 LGBTQ Abuse Continues in Qatar In Spite of World Cup Event

I've posted about the abuse and homophobia in Qatar earlier this month, and now it's making news again. This time is because Preventive Security forces in Qatar are now arresting LGBTQ people in public places at random. 

Human Rights Watch has been documenting what's been happening and so far they have at least 6 cases of LGBTQ abuse and Qatar is forcing conversion therapy on some.
